Fashion Club is a unique program for kids and teens, thoughtfully developed by fashion designer and educator Anzhela
Martynava. This program offers students ongoing education in the art of making clothing within a caring environment.
Running from September through May, Fashion Club develops creativity and skills step by step, ensuring students'
growth and enjoyment throughout the school year. We welcome new students as well as those returning from last year.
 
Fashion Club focuses on a list of knowledge and skills:

  • Designer room/ work room flow
  • Tools and materials for creating garmens
  • First knowledge of operating a sewing machine
  • Textile and cutting techniques
  • Iron and ironing techniques
  • Sketching as idea visualisation
  • Basic skills of pattern making
  • Steps of creating a garment from concept to product
  • Machine stitches and hand sewing
  • Introduction to the overlock
  • Heat transfer for a t-shirt
  • Basic knowledge about the Fashion Show as a representation of a complete concept
In addition, teens will also explore:

  • Expanded knowledge of textiles and innovation in the textile industry.
  • Understanding of natural and manufactured fibers
  • Fashion Illustration and Technical Drawing
  • Basic knowledge of collection development
  • Steps of putting a zipper in pants, skirts, and jackets (closed-end and open-end zippers)
  • Pockets
  • Buttons and buttonholes
  • Skills working on overlock/serger and coverstitch machines
  • Introduction to embroidery machines
  • Christmas Market as a play model of the business aspect of fashion
  • The Fashion Show as a self-expression platform
